Adams - Female

Hook - Mustad 94840 or equivalent, size 10-20
Thread - Black
Wings - Grizzly hen hackle tips
Tail - Grizzly & brown hackle fibers, mixed
Egg sac - Yellow dubbing
Body - Gray dubbing
Hackle - Grizzly & brown

White Jungle Cock

Hook - Mustad Heritage

Thread - Black

Tip - Scarlet

Tail - Golden pheasant tippet

Body - White wool

Hackle - White

Wing - Jungle cock*

Trout - Ray Bergman

*The book recipe does not represent the drawing on plate 9 in the book. 

White goose quill segments were used to replicate the drawing

Royal Coachman Streamers - Feather Wing, Hair Wing, Marabou

Royal-Coachman-Streamer-Featherwing.jpg

 

Royal-Coachman-Streamer-Hairwing.jpg

 

Royal-Coachman-Streamer-Marabou.jpg

 

Hook: #4 and #6

Thread: black, 6/0

Tail: GP tippets

Rib: small copper wire or C&C silver metallic thread

Body: peacock herl, red wood yarn or red floss,  peacock herl

Collar: male ringneck breast feather or badger India neck

Wing: White rooster neck hackles x 4 or polar bear or white marabou

Coastal Shiner

Hook - Mustad 3665A or substitute
Thread - Black
Tail - Furnace hackle fibers
Rib - Oval silver tinsel
Body - White chenille
Throat - Furnace hackle fibers
Wing - Furnace saddle hackles

The Classic Streamer Fly Box

Golden Pheasant

Hook - Mustad Heritage
Thread - Black
Tip - Gold tinsel
Tail - Black hackle fibers
Ribbing - Gold tinsel
Body - Orange floss
Hackle - Orange hackle fibers
Wing - Golden pheasant tippet

Trout - Ray Bergman

Some really nice tying so far this month. My hat is off to all of you. Here's a hopper that I twisted up. A little odd this a little odd that. 

Hook: Size 10 2x long

Underbody: hopper yellow floating polypro yarn, twisted tight. 

Overbody: tan fly foam 2mm. Cut about the width of the hook gape

Kickers: knotted, what a pain,  pheasant tail fibers

Under-underwing, yellow Krystal flash

Underwing: hopper yellow web wing

Wing: select cow elk

Legs: chartreuse and black barred 

Head: extension of the body.

largest mayfly in the U.S. dark green drake, (Litobrancha recurvata) or dark green drake, is the largest mayfly. Not as many as Hexigenia limbata but is larger.they hatch on pine creek between last week of august and 2nd week of september

March Brown - American

Hook - Mustad Heritage
Thread - Black
Tip - Gold tinsel
Ribbing - Gold Tinsel
Body - Brown
Hackle - Brown
Wing - Brown turkey

Trout - Ray Bergman

Mole

Hook - Wet fly style
Thread - Black
Hackle - Brown, palmered
Body - Gray wool
Wing - Brown turkey

* I added a fine gold wire wrap to help secure the palmered hackle

Trout - Ray Bergman
